NOVELTY - Preparation of high-heat-conductivity antistatic graphene/polycarbonate (PC) masterbatch comprises adding PC powder to organic solvent, and heating to 60-90 degrees C and stirring for 30-40 minutes to form 0.03-0.05 g/mL transparent pure polymer solution; slowly adding graphene powder at 0-1 g/minute, continuously heating for 10-15 minutes, and ultrasonically dispersing to form graphene intercalated PC solution; removing and recovering mixed solution by rotary evaporation, and slowly evaporating solvent to obtain graphene/PC composite material, in which different concentrations of graphene/PC masterbatch are prepared by changing amount of graphene added; grinding the composite material with small amount of organic solvent, and keeping in blast oven at 80-90 degrees C for 4-5 hours to evaporate organic solvent or decomposed water to obtain dark graphene/PC masterbatch powder; and pressing using four-column flat vulcanizing machine and special mold. USE - Method for preparing high-heat-conductivity antistatic graphene/polycarbonate masterbatch used for making radiation shielding material. ADVANTAGE - The method can prepare polycarbonate masterbatch with different concentrations of graphene by simple solution blending, and avoids destruction of graphene sheet structure during melt processing. The graphene can be uniformly dispersed in polycarbonate to improve electrical conductivity and thermal conductivity of composite material and improve antistatic performance of plastic.
